===== REQUIREMENTS =====
  - Python (2.5) (www.python.org)
  - PyYaml (>3.05) (www.yaml.org)
  - PyGTK (>2.13) (www.pygtk.org)
  
    === Ubuntu/Debian ===
    sudo apt-get install python-yaml python-gtk2
    
    === Fedora ===
    yum -y install python-devel PyYAML
    

===== INSTALL =====
As root run 'python setup.py install'
(installs into path-to-python/site-packages/)


===== RUN =====
After installing you can run the command "rednotebook" in any shell. 
You should also find a menu entry for RedNotebook under "Office".

(Running without installing: Just navigate to the "rednotebook" directory 
                             and run "./rednotebook".)
